Pearl Gladys Jansen (born 1950 in Bonteheuwel) is a South African beauty queen and singer who ends up first runner-up in the Miss World beauty contest in the UK in 1970. She became the first coloured woman to represent her country at this level even if she competed as "Miss Africa South" due to apartheid.
